If you are going for overloads, you'll want to make extremes even though they are pretty expensive. I think Sara brews are your best bet until you hit the untradeable pots. Sy_Accursed Posted March 16, 2012 Share Posted March 16, 2012 81>90 you want to make extremes, regardless of cost. Say (for simplicites sake) each extreme costs 1m per 1k pots.The cheapest training method is 500k per 1m xp. Then say 81>90 is 5m xpDo 1k of each extreme = 5mDo 5k of the cheap method = 2.5m BUT Extremes are untradable.Do the cheap method and you do have the level to make overloads but need to spend a lot more money to actually make any overloads.Do the extremes and you have the level and the majority of the supplies for overload making with torstols being the only remaining cost. So say you wanted 1k overloads and 1k torstols cost a further 1mExtremes method: You've done 1k each of the 5 extreme pots for 5m, pay 1m more for 1k torstols. That's 1k overloads for 6m.Cheap xp method: You've spent 2.5m. You now have to spend 5m to make the 1k of each extreme pot and 1m on torstols. That's 1k of overloads for a total cost of 9.5m Of course I am using vastly simplified numbers for the sake of a clear example, but the principle applies when you do the real thing. In the 81>90(or 99) range doing extremes results in lower cost long term than opting for cheap xp as it produces the xp AND something useful. Opposed to producing ONLY xp and then having to invest again anyway to get the actual overloads.
